您的位置: 网站首页> it面试题> 当前文章
在ClickHouse中如何处理复杂的多表连接查询?
老董-我爱我家房产SEO2024-03-16176围观,136赞
1、优化JOIN策略: 根据数据大小和连接条件,选择合适的JOIN策略(如HASH JOIN或MERGE JOIN)来优化查询性能。
2、使用任何JOIN: ClickHouse的ANY和ALL JOIN类型可以用于优化连接查询,减少数据重复处理。
3、限制数据量: 在连接查询中使用合适的过滤条件,减少参与连接的数据量。
4、合理设计表结构: 尽可能在设计阶段优化表结构,利用分区和索引来加速连接操作。
5、分布式查询: 在分布式环境中,合理分配数据分片和副本,以实现查询的负载均衡和高效执行。

很赞哦!
python编程网提示:转载请注明来源www.python66.com。
有宝贵意见可添加站长微信(底部),获取技术资料请到公众号(底部)。同行交流请加群
相关文章
文章评论
-
在ClickHouse中如何处理复杂的多表连接查询?文章写得不错,值得赞赏


